This route from Fresno, California to Birmingham, Alabama spans nearly 1,900 miles, involving cross-country logistics. Understanding the distance, delivery timelines, and service options is key to a smooth relocation.
The estimated distance of 1,868 miles is based on the most direct driving route between Fresno and Birmingham.
This is an interstate move because it crosses state lines from California to Alabama.
Due to the long distance, professional movers typically schedule delivery over several days to comply with driving time regulations and ensure safety.

Expect moving costs from Fresno to Birmingham to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,808 to $1,901, medium moves from $2,079 to $2,186, and large moves from $2,350 to $2,471.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es from professional movers can help you find the best fit for your budget and needs.

Standard delivery usually takes about 4 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 3 days. Actual timing depends on the moving company’s schedule and route logistics.
The most affordable option is typically a self-service move where you pack yourself and hire movers only for loading and unloading. Comparing quotes from multiple long distance movers can help identify cost-effective choices.
Booking at least several weeks in advance is recommended to secure preferred dates and rates. Last-minute bookings may result in higher prices or limited availability.
Yes, moving companies operating between states like California and Alabama must be licensed as interstate movers by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and protection.
